Access the HR Hub on a smartphone

This guide explains how to access the HR Hub on your smartphone using the RosterElf mobile app. The HR Hub is where staff can review and complete important employment tasks, such as contracts, certificates, licences, and personal details. Using the HR Hub on your phone helps you stay updated and manage your information without needing a computer.

By following this guide, you’ll learn how to open the app, navigate to the correct menu, and select the HR Hub. Each step is simple and designed to help you find and complete your HR items quickly. Once you know where to go, you can review required documents, update your details, and support your compliance efforts with your workplace requirements.

1. Accessing the HR Hub on your smartphone

This section explains how to find the HR Hub from the main menu in the RosterElf mobile app. You’ll start by opening the app, then navigating to the More menu where the HR Hub is located. These steps help you access your personal HR information quickly and ensure you can complete any outstanding tasks your employer requires.

1.1 locate the HR Hub in the App

1.1.1 Open the RosterElf smartphone app.

1.1.2 Press More on the bottom menu.

1.1.3 Select My HR Hub.

1.1.4 Choose a section to review or complete, then hit Save.

2. Uploading a certificate or licence

This section covers uploading a certificate, licence, or permit from your phone — for example an RSA certificate, White Card, First Aid certificate, or Working with Children Check (Blue Card). Your employer sets up which certifications apply to your role; once one appears in your HR Hub, you can supply your own details for it directly from the app.

2.1 upload your document

2.1.1 Open My HR Hub and select the certificate, licence, or permit item, such as Working with Children Check.

2.1.2 Photograph or upload the document from your phone.

2.1.3 Add the expiry date if the item requires one.

2.1.4 Submit the item for your manager’s approval.

Frequently asked questions

1. How do I access the HR Hub on my smartphone?

Open the RosterElf mobile app, press More on the bottom menu, and select My HR Hub. From there, choose any section you want to review or complete.

2. What can I do in the HR Hub on the RosterElf app?

The HR Hub lets you review and complete key employment tasks such as contracts, certificates, licences, personal details, and other required HR items, including assigned training courses. It helps you support your compliance efforts and keep your information updated.

3. Do I need a computer to complete my HR tasks in RosterElf?

No, you can complete all required HR tasks directly from your smartphone using the RosterElf app. The HR Hub is designed to make your HR information easy to manage on the go.

4. Why can't I find the HR Hub in the app menu?

If you can’t find the HR Hub, check that your app is updated to the latest version. Then open the app, press More on the bottom menu, and look for My HR Hub. If it still doesn’t appear, your employer may not have enabled it yet.

5. Can I update my personal details in the HR Hub?

Yes, you can update personal details such as contact information, licences, certificates, and other required records directly within the HR Hub on your smartphone.

6. How do I upload my Working with Children Check (Blue Card) in the app?

Open My HR Hub, select the Certificates & Permits item your employer has set up for it (for example, Working with Children Check), then photograph or upload the document, add the expiry date if required, and submit it for approval. Your manager will need to have added Working with Children Check as a certification first — see manage certificates and permits in HR Hub for how they set that up.
